To stay in shape many of us work out on a regular basis. The goal is defined: Muscle building. Gyms are gaining more and more customers, but only a few of us know how important the right nutrients are to build muscles. Only a stable and healthy diet can achieve the goals we set. A key role is the intake of protein. Not many are aware of the fact that protein is essential for us. The amino acids which are the major content of the protein, are part of our skin, nails, hairs, and of course our muscles. In addition, they are part of our chemical messengers in our brain. Our food intake lacks protein, which reduces immune system strength and muscle building. The natural balance of protein and carbs is uneven.

 

Most times diseases, stress, diets, and environmental influences play a major role. Amino acids are next to carbs and fats the major piece of the metabolism, and therefore they are an important key to muscle building. Eating habits which are embossed by stress and time pressure, don't cover the essential energy demand. In particular sports person need to be aware of their protein intake. Only the continuous intake of protein lets the goal of muscle building come many steps closer. Amino acids speed up recovery processes between workouts and recovery times.
